Here's the story our grandparents told us.
Sir
Charles Slingsby married a French lady in France at the time of the French
revolution.
He brought her back to England and they had progeny. (a
son I think to inherit).
When Sir Charles was drowned in the ferry
accident no one could produce a marriage certificate because all the records
were destroyed in the churches during the Revolution - or at least the one in
question. It seemed that it was not possible to pass on his title and
assets, and the estates went to his sister and then to Charles Atkinson.
There is a book in print composed of pioneer letters (it's about Perry's
wife's family i.e.Baker )
in which his prospective father-in-law reports
that "Aggie is being courted by Perry Fall. He's a pretty good chap, and says
he's the son of a baronet."
If things happened as I have related above,
it appears that Perry's family was the direct descendent of Sir Charles, albeit
they were disinherited. I found a genealogy for Sir Charles which stated
that he had no spouse.
This rumour has been in our family for over 100
years now.
I'm wondering how to trace Perry's ancestors, because we all
want to know where the Fall name came from.
Perry (no middle name) was
born in Tolerton, subdistrict Whixley, City of York, Yorkshire in 1866..
His parents were Mary Selina Perry * and Joseph Fall.
* On Perry's marriage
certificate it says Eliza Sarah Perry. Not sure which.
In an
interview with an older member of the Fall family, Betty Fall, she told me that
Joseph was a surgeon, and that the family was in the midst of an inheritance
claim. It was said that Joseph spent his fortune trying to reclaim the
Slingsby estate, but that he was not successful.
OneGreatFamily lists a
Joseph Fall born 1837 Whitkirk Leeds York. Perry was born 1866 (I also
have 1865). Sounds like he could be Perry's father.
